Key Insights of Japan Matte Cream Concealer Market
- Market Valuation: Estimated at approximately $350 million in 2023, with steady growth driven by rising beauty consciousness and premiumization trends.
- Forecast Trajectory: Projected to reach $520 million by 2030, reflecting a CAGR of around 6.2% during 2026–2033.
- Dominant Segment: Premium and luxury brands hold over 55% market share, driven by affluent consumer segments seeking high-quality, long-lasting formulations.
- Core Application: Primarily used for everyday makeup, with increasing demand in professional and social media-driven contexts.
- Leading Geography: Tokyo metropolitan area accounts for nearly 40% of sales, followed by Osaka and Nagoya, due to urban density and higher disposable incomes.
- Market Opportunities: Growing interest in clean beauty, eco-friendly packaging, and innovative textures presents significant avenues for differentiation.
- Major Players: Shiseido, Kanebo, and Kosé dominate, with emerging brands focusing on niche markets and digital-first strategies.
Market Dynamics of Japan Matte Cream Concealer Market
The Japanese beauty industry is characterized by a mature yet highly innovative environment, where consumer preferences lean towards high-performance, aesthetically appealing, and skin-friendly products. The matte cream concealer segment benefits from Japan’s reputation for quality and technological innovation, with brands investing heavily in R&D to develop formulations that offer superior coverage, longevity, and skin compatibility. The market’s growth is also fueled by the rising influence of social media influencers and beauty vloggers, which accelerates demand for trendy, photogenic makeup products.
Consumer behavior in Japan emphasizes natural looks with a preference for products that enhance skin health without causing irritation. This has led to a surge in demand for formulations with skincare benefits, such as hydration, anti-aging, and UV protection. The competitive landscape is marked by a mix of established multinational corporations and agile local startups, all vying for market share through innovation, branding, and digital marketing. Regulatory standards around product safety and sustainability are increasingly shaping product development strategies, aligning with global trends toward eco-conscious beauty.
Dynamic Market Research Perspective: Porter’s Five Forces Analysis of Japan Matte Cream Concealer Market
- Threat of New Entrants: Moderate, due to high brand loyalty, significant R&D costs, and stringent regulations but mitigated by the lucrative growth potential.
- Bargaining Power of Suppliers: Low to moderate; key ingredients like pigments and emulsifiers are sourced globally, with multiple suppliers ensuring competitive pricing.
- Bargaining Power of Buyers: High; consumers are well-informed, demanding high-quality, eco-friendly, and innovative products, which intensifies competition.
- Threat of Substitutes: Moderate; alternative products like liquid concealers or BB creams pose competition, but matte cream formulations offer unique aesthetic and functional benefits.
- Industry Rivalry: Intense; major brands compete on innovation, packaging, and marketing, with a focus on digital engagement and sustainability initiatives.
